Poland’s economy grows by 1.7 per cent again
The Central Statistics Office in Warsaw reported on Monday that Poland's GDP rose by 1.7 per cent in the third quarter from the same period a year ago. This figure is above expert expectations that expected 1.5 per cent rise.

Poland is going to receive 400 million Euro from EBRD
Influential daily “Gazeta Wyborcza” reported yesterday that Poland is going to receive at least 400 million Euro from the European Bank for Reconstruction and Development in 2010. This money will be spent on investment in infrastructure that is needed.

Manager of “Śnieżka” wins businessman of the year award
Piotr Mikrut, the manager and one of the owners of paint manufacturing company “Śnieżka”, has won “Ernst & Young Polish businessman of the year” award. He is going to represent Poland in “Ernst & Young World Entrepreneur of the Year" competition.

Poland’s unemployment rate goes up again
Poland’s economy is still on the rise, but unfortunately the unemployment rate shows the same tendency. At the end of October it soared to new heights of 11.1 per cent after five months on the rise. It is not as dramatic as in 2003, when one in five Poles was unemployed, but it is not encouraging.
